Recall Details
Raleigh, N.C., Jan. 14, 2026 — Family Dollar, Inc. has initiated a voluntary retail-level recall of certain over-the-counter drugs, medical devices, cosmetics, dietary supplements, and human and pet food products after discovering evidence of rodents and rodent activity at its Distribution Center 202 in West Memphis, Arkansas; the primary risk is possible contamination with Salmonella, and consumers should stop using or eating any potentially affected products immediately.
The recall covers all affected product types with lot code(s) tied to items shipped from Distribution Center 202 to 404 Family Dollar stores; the affected items have been sold since Jan. 1, 2021. Products shipped directly to stores by manufacturers or distributors (including all frozen and refrigerated items) are not included. Affected items were sold online and at select U.S. retailers and at the named Family Dollar locations listed on the company’s affected-stores schedule; customers should consult that list to determine whether their store is included.
Family Dollar is asking stores to quarantine and discontinue sale of affected stock and is advising customers to return contaminated items to the store of purchase for a refund or replacement, with no receipt required, or to dispose of them if returning is impractical. Consumers with questions may contact Family Dollar Customer Service at 844-636-7687 (9 a.m.–5 p.m. EST) or email [email protected]; anyone who has experienced illness should contact their physician, and pet owners with concerns should contact a veterinarian. Adverse events or quality problems can be reported to FDA MedWatch online or by using the MedWatch form (request by calling 1-800-332-1088 or faxing to 1-800-FDA-0178).
